Home
last modified time | relevance | path

Searched refs:lp_advertising (Results 1 – 25 of 25) sorted by relevance

/linux/include/linux/
H A Dmii.h413 static inline void mii_lpa_to_linkmode_lpa_t(unsigned long *lp_advertising, in mii_lpa_to_linkmode_lpa_t() argument
416 mii_adv_to_linkmode_adv_t(lp_advertising, lpa); in mii_lpa_to_linkmode_lpa_t()
420 lp_advertising); in mii_lpa_to_linkmode_lpa_t()
432 static inline void mii_lpa_mod_linkmode_lpa_t(unsigned long *lp_advertising, in mii_lpa_mod_linkmode_lpa_t() argument
435 mii_adv_mod_linkmode_adv_t(lp_advertising, lpa); in mii_lpa_mod_linkmode_lpa_t()
438 lp_advertising, lpa & LPA_LPACK); in mii_lpa_mod_linkmode_lpa_t()
H A Dethtool.h238 __ETHTOOL_DECLARE_LINK_MODE_MASK(lp_advertising);
/linux/net/ethtool/
H A Dlinkmodes.c52 bitmap_empty(data->ksettings.link_modes.lp_advertising, in linkmodes_prepare_data()
83 ret = ethnl_bitset_size(ksettings->link_modes.lp_advertising, in linkmodes_reply_size()
122 ksettings->link_modes.lp_advertising, in linkmodes_fill_reply()
H A Dioctl.c401 &legacy_settings->lp_advertising, in convert_link_ksettings_to_legacy_settings()
402 link_ksettings->link_modes.lp_advertising); in convert_link_ksettings_to_legacy_settings()
433 __u32 lp_advertising[__ETHTOOL_LINK_MODE_MASK_NU32]; member
472 bitmap_from_arr32(to->link_modes.lp_advertising, in load_link_ksettings_from_user()
473 link_usettings.link_modes.lp_advertising, in load_link_ksettings_from_user()
493 bitmap_empty(cmd->link_modes.lp_advertising, in ethtool_virtdev_validate_cmd()
514 bitmap_to_arr32(link_usettings.link_modes.lp_advertising, in store_link_ksettings_for_user()
515 from->link_modes.lp_advertising, in store_link_ksettings_for_user()
H A Dcommon.c559 link_ksettings->link_modes.lp_advertising, in convert_legacy_settings_to_link_ksettings()
560 legacy_settings->lp_advertising); in convert_legacy_settings_to_link_ksettings()
/linux/drivers/net/ethernet/marvell/prestera/
H A Dprestera_ethtool.c446 prestera_modes_to_eth(ecmd->link_modes.lp_advertising, in prestera_port_remote_cap_get()
449 if (!bitmap_empty(ecmd->link_modes.lp_advertising, in prestera_port_remote_cap_get()
452 lp_advertising, in prestera_port_remote_cap_get()
461 lp_advertising, in prestera_port_remote_cap_get()
465 lp_advertising, in prestera_port_remote_cap_get()
520 ethtool_link_ksettings_zero_link_mode(ecmd, lp_advertising); in prestera_ethtool_get_link_ksettings()
/linux/drivers/net/ethernet/aquantia/atlantic/
H A Daq_nic.c1224 ethtool_link_ksettings_zero_link_mode(cmd, lp_advertising); in aq_nic_get_link_ksettings()
1228 ethtool_link_ksettings_add_link_mode(cmd, lp_advertising, in aq_nic_get_link_ksettings()
1232 ethtool_link_ksettings_add_link_mode(cmd, lp_advertising, in aq_nic_get_link_ksettings()
1236 ethtool_link_ksettings_add_link_mode(cmd, lp_advertising, in aq_nic_get_link_ksettings()
1240 ethtool_link_ksettings_add_link_mode(cmd, lp_advertising, in aq_nic_get_link_ksettings()
1244 ethtool_link_ksettings_add_link_mode(cmd, lp_advertising, in aq_nic_get_link_ksettings()
1248 ethtool_link_ksettings_add_link_mode(cmd, lp_advertising, in aq_nic_get_link_ksettings()
1252 ethtool_link_ksettings_add_link_mode(cmd, lp_advertising, in aq_nic_get_link_ksettings()
1256 ethtool_link_ksettings_add_link_mode(cmd, lp_advertising, in aq_nic_get_link_ksettings()
1260 ethtool_link_ksettings_add_link_mode(cmd, lp_advertising, in aq_nic_get_link_ksettings()
[all …]
/linux/drivers/net/phy/
H A Dbroadcom.c1305 phydev->lp_advertising); in lre_read_lpa()
1316 phydev->lp_advertising, in lre_read_lpa()
1319 phydev->lp_advertising, in lre_read_lpa()
1322 phydev->lp_advertising, in lre_read_lpa()
1325 phydev->lp_advertising, in lre_read_lpa()
1328 linkmode_zero(phydev->lp_advertising); in lre_read_lpa()
H A Dmotorcomm.c1217 mii_stat1000_mod_linkmode_lpa_t(phydev->lp_advertising, in ytphy_utp_read_lpa()
1219 mii_lpa_mod_linkmode_lpa_t(phydev->lp_advertising, 0); in ytphy_utp_read_lpa()
1241 mii_stat1000_mod_linkmode_lpa_t(phydev->lp_advertising, in ytphy_utp_read_lpa()
1249 mii_lpa_mod_linkmode_lpa_t(phydev->lp_advertising, lpa); in ytphy_utp_read_lpa()
1251 linkmode_zero(phydev->lp_advertising); in ytphy_utp_read_lpa()
1320 phydev->lp_advertising, lpa & LPA_1000XFULL); in yt8521_adjust_status()
1354 linkmode_zero(phydev->lp_advertising); in yt8521_read_status_paged()
H A Dair_en8811h.c1101 phydev->lp_advertising, in en8811h_read_status()
1131 phydev->lp_advertising, in en8811h_read_status()
/linux/drivers/net/dsa/mv88e6xxx/
H A Dserdes.c96 mii_lpa_mod_linkmode_x(state->lp_advertising, lpa, in mv88e6xxx_pcs_decode_state()
99 mii_lpa_mod_linkmode_x(state->lp_advertising, lpa, in mv88e6xxx_pcs_decode_state()
/linux/drivers/net/ethernet/intel/ice/
H A Dice_ethtool.c2248 ethtool_link_ksettings_add_link_mode(ks, lp_advertising, in ice_get_settings_link_up()
2254 ethtool_link_ksettings_add_link_mode(ks, lp_advertising, Pause); in ice_get_settings_link_up()
2257 ethtool_link_ksettings_add_link_mode(ks, lp_advertising, Pause); in ice_get_settings_link_up()
2258 ethtool_link_ksettings_add_link_mode(ks, lp_advertising, in ice_get_settings_link_up()
2262 ethtool_link_ksettings_add_link_mode(ks, lp_advertising, in ice_get_settings_link_up()
2267 ethtool_link_ksettings_del_link_mode(ks, lp_advertising, Pause); in ice_get_settings_link_up()
2268 ethtool_link_ksettings_del_link_mode(ks, lp_advertising, in ice_get_settings_link_up()
2314 ethtool_link_ksettings_zero_link_mode(ks, lp_advertising); in ice_get_link_ksettings()
/linux/drivers/net/phy/realtek/
H A Drealtek_main.c1394 mii_10gbt_stat_mod_linkmode_lpa_t(phydev->lp_advertising, 0); in rtl822x_read_status()
1408 mii_10gbt_stat_mod_linkmode_lpa_t(phydev->lp_advertising, lpadv); in rtl822x_read_status()
1475 mii_stat1000_mod_linkmode_lpa_t(phydev->lp_advertising, val); in rtl822x_c45_read_status()
/linux/drivers/net/phy/qcom/
H A Dqca808x.c266 linkmode_mod_bit(ETHTOOL_LINK_MODE_2500baseT_Full_BIT, phydev->lp_advertising, in qca808x_read_status()
/linux/drivers/net/ethernet/mellanox/mlx5/core/
H A Den_ethtool.c1205 unsigned long *lp_advertising = link_ksettings->link_modes.lp_advertising; in get_lp_advertising() local
1208 ptys2ethtool_process_link(eth_proto_lp, ext, true, lp_advertising); in get_lp_advertising()
1283 lp_advertising, Autoneg); in mlx5e_ethtool_get_link_ksettings()
/linux/drivers/net/ethernet/hisilicon/hns3/hns3pf/
H A Dhclge_cmd.h862 __le32 lp_advertising; member
H A Dhclge_main.c3317 u32 supported, advertising, lp_advertising; in hclge_get_phy_link_ksettings() local
3345 lp_advertising = le32_to_cpu(req0->lp_advertising); in hclge_get_phy_link_ksettings()
3350 ethtool_convert_legacy_u32_to_link_mode(cmd->link_modes.lp_advertising, in hclge_get_phy_link_ksettings()
3351 lp_advertising); in hclge_get_phy_link_ksettings()
/linux/drivers/net/ethernet/fungible/funcore/
H A Dfun_hci.h732 __be64 lp_advertising; member
/linux/drivers/net/ethernet/chelsio/cxgb4/
H A Dcxgb4_ethtool.c677 ethtool_link_ksettings_zero_link_mode(link_ksettings, lp_advertising); in get_link_ksettings()
699 link_ksettings->link_modes.lp_advertising); in get_link_ksettings()
/linux/drivers/net/ethernet/sfc/siena/
H A Dmcdi_port_common.c566 cmd->link_modes.lp_advertising); in efx_siena_mcdi_phy_get_link_ksettings()
/linux/drivers/net/ethernet/sfc/
H A Dmcdi_port_common.c553 cmd->link_modes.lp_advertising); in efx_mcdi_phy_get_link_ksettings()
/linux/drivers/net/ethernet/chelsio/cxgb4vf/
H A Dcxgb4vf_main.c1451 ethtool_link_ksettings_zero_link_mode(link_ksettings, lp_advertising); in cxgb4vf_get_link_ksettings()
1470 link_ksettings->link_modes.lp_advertising); in cxgb4vf_get_link_ksettings()
/linux/drivers/net/ethernet/qlogic/qede/
H A Dqede_ethtool.c518 linkmode_copy(link_modes->lp_advertising, current_link.lp_caps); in qede_get_link_ksettings()
/linux/drivers/net/usb/
H A Dr8152.c8791 cmd->link_modes.lp_advertising, in rtl8152_get_link_ksettings()
/linux/drivers/net/ethernet/broadcom/
H A Dtg3.c12307 cmd->link_modes.lp_advertising, in tg3_get_link_ksettings()